Rat's Nest is a large indoor [[vehicles]] map that resembles an area from the campaign level [[Crow's Nest ( | Rat's Nest is a large indoor [[vehicles]] map that resembles an area from the campaign level [[Crow's Nest (location)|Crow's Nest]], with internal vehicle accessible roads, tight corridors, walkways suspended above areas and vents. In the distance, [[D77H-TCI Pelican|Pelicans]] and [[AV-14 Hornet|Hornets]] pass by. "Rat's Nest" is the colloquial name for the ammunition storage facility of Crow's Nest and was used by the [[UNSC]] to store munitions and fuel up until the [[Covenant]] attack on the base.{{Ref/Reuse|wp earth}} | ||
On November 19, 2007, [[Microsoft]] released information regarding the first ''Halo 3'' [[Heroic Map Pack]].<ref>[http://www.xbox.com/en-US/games/h/halo3/news/20071119-heroicmappack.htm].</ref> Rat's Nest is one of the maps included in this bundle. The map pack retailed for 800 Microsoft Points (US$10), and was released on December 11, 2007. This map is, essentially, a big figure 8 track (note, a digital 8, meaning vehicles must turn 90 degrees to cross straight from one side to the next). The map is extremely open and vehicle-based around its perimeter and center, with close combat and medium-sized rooms everywhere else. It has two [[M12 Warthog|Warthog]]s and [[M274 Mongoose|Mongoose]]s parked outside of both bases. Small rooms connect each base.
